    Here, I found some old photos of that Focke-Wulf FW-190D-13.....like I said, last time I saw it in person it was just a fuselage laying in the dirt next to a hangar. Notice it has exhaust stacks for a V12, not a radial. I hear this was known as the "Dora" model, the "long-nosed Dora" is what I was told. Oooooh, a startup video!
    That Dora actually had wooden propeller blades late in the war! Awesome machine.
